tiometers attached to the X and Y axis. When the position of the
control stick is determined, certain control information is trans-
mitted to the robot. Because a wireless data link is being used to
remotely control the robot, the experimenter is not limited to a
certain number of control channels, as are imposed when a regu-
lar model airplane remote control system is used. The experi-
menter has the option of adding any number of other devices.
